Join our growing Service Cloud team as a Customer Service and Field Service Sales Specialist. You will be responsible for leveraging the untapped opportunities across the Service Cloud space with the leading Customer Service and Field Service offering in your bag. You will work in partnership with the account owners, the Core Account Executive team.

In this role you will formulate and implement a Service Cloud Field Service sales strategy, leading the way with AI and Agentforce, drive revenue growth by penetrating the current customer base, and develop new customers in the enterprise space. This role will work with Enterprise Business Unit (Large Accounts). And both existing accounts as well as prospects- and seek to build new relationships in a set of assigned territories.

Your ImpactThis unique position collaborates internally and externally to position the incredible value of key Service Cloud Field Service solutions supported by additional products as; Appointment Booking, Virtual Remote Assistance, Self-Service and Knowledge portals as well as natively embedded scheduling and dispatching functionality into the market leader customer engagement platform, Salesforce Service Cloud. You will work closely with current- and prospective customers as a trusted advisor to deeply understand their unique company challenges and goals. You will identify opportunities across the broader Service Cloud offerings to help them reach their business goals and blaze new trails within their organizations.
